Current Market Trends
Over the past few years, Apple has expanded its lineup to include more affordable MacBook models. The introduction of the MacBook Air with M1 and M2 chips has been a game-changer, offering powerful performance at a lower price point. Consumers now have access to devices that balance cost, portability, and performance without compromising quality.
Shift Towards M1 and M2 Chips
The shift from Intel processors to Apple Silicon chips has significantly impacted the market. MacBooks equipped with M1 and M2 chips provide faster processing speeds, improved battery life, and better integration with macOS. These advancements have made budget-friendly MacBooks more appealing to students, professionals, and casual users alike.
Price Range and Availability
Most MacBooks under $1500 are now primarily found in the MacBook Air series. These devices typically range from $999 to $1299, depending on specifications and configurations. Retailers often offer discounts and refurbished models, making high-quality MacBooks more accessible to a broader audience.
